The Mayo Clinic article lists numerous conditions which make consulting a doctor a must before starting an exercise regimen. Wha

t do these conditions have in common and what conditions are not listed that might require medical attention before starting an exercise regimen?

Answer and Explanation: We know that starting an exercise regime is very demanding and physically challenging job. All kind of exercise regime includes strength games as well as cardiovascular games. During cardiovascular games heart and lungs play very important role, your heartbeat increases and a lot of pressure is buildup on your lungs. Any medical condition in which you cannot use full capacity your heart and lungs is to be taken into consideration before planning any such activity. Some of the medical conditions are:

  • Cardiovascular diseases: Medical conditions related to heart can cause sudden death upon extreme exertion.
  • Respiratory diseases: Medical conditions such as acute lung infections and asthma can kill a person by choking him/her if involved in extreme strenuous games.
  • Arthritis issues: Your bones becomes weak and are prone to break down in no time, thus they are advised not to put extreme strain on bones to avoid any irreparable damage.
